03-19-1990 MinutesAction 90-096 90-097 CITY OF SALINA, KANSAS REGULAR ;MEETING OF THE BOARD OF COMMISSIONERS MARCH 19, 1990 4:00 p.m. The Regular Meeting of the Board of Commissioners met in the Commission Meeting Room, City -County Building, on Monday, March 19, 1990, at 4:00 p.m. There were present: Mayor Joseph A. Warner, Chairman presiding Commissioner Carol E. Beggs Commissioner John Divine Commissioner Robert E. Frank Commissioner Stephen C. Ryan comprising a quorum of the Board, also present: Greg Bengtson, City Attorney William E. Harris, Acting City Manager Jacqueline Shiever, City Clerk Absent: Dennis M. Kissinger, City Manager CITIZEN FORUM None AWARDS - PROCLAMATIONS None PUBLIC HEARINGS AND ITEMS SCHEDULED FOR A CERTAIN TIME (5.1) Public Hearing on 1990 CDBG Community Improvement Program. Mayor Warner declared the public hearing open. There were no comments filed, written or oral, so the Mayor declared the public hearing closed. Roy Dudark, Director of Planning and Community Development, reviewed the CDBG Community Improvement Program. Moved by Commissioner Divine, seconded by Commissioner Frank that April 9, 1990 be set for the final public hearing and that staff be instructed to prepare a formal application for consideration at the final public hearing. Aye: (5). Nay: (0). Motion adopted. CONSENT AGENDA (6.1) Approve the Minutes of the Regular Meeting March 12, 1990. (6.2) Petition Number 3988, filed by James T. Graves, Attorney for Bank IV, Salina, N.A., Trustee of Graves Trusts, for the establishment of a special improvement district for the purpose of payment of the cost of certain storm drainage retention improvements related to Mariposa Subdivision. [Refer the petition to the City Engineer for a recommendation. ) Moved by Commissioner Frank, seconded by Commissioner Ryan that all items on the Consent Agenda be approved. Aye: (5) . Nay: (0) . Motion adopted. None DEVELOPMENT BUSINESS Action 90-098 90-099 ADMINISTRATION (8.1) Second Reading Ordinance Number 90-9373, repealing Section 27-17 of the Salina Code regarding animals in City parks. Moved by Commissioner Ryan, seconded by Commissioner Frank that Ordinance Number 90-9373, repealing Section 27-17 of the Salina Code regarding animals in City parks, be adopted. Aye: Beggs, Divine, Frank, Ryan, Warner (5) . Nay: (0) . Motion adopted. (8.2) Resolution Number 90-4176, authorizing the Mayor to execute and the City Clerk to attest a consent to assignment and assumption of undivided one-third tenant's interest and to mortgage of leasehold estate. [ "The Doctors" Industrial Revenue Bond issue.] Greg Bengtson, City Attorney, reviewed "the Doctors" IRB application and reviewed the consent to assignment. He introduced Dr. Norman Macy in the audience who was present to answer any questions of the City Commission. Moved by Commissioner Divine, seconded by Commissioner Ryan that Resolution Number 90-4176, authorizing the Mayor to execute and the City Clerk to attest a consent to assignment and assumption of undivided one-third tenant's interest and to mortgage of leasehold estate, be adopted. Aye: (5). Nay: (0). Motion adopted. OTHER BUSINESS Mayor Warner announced the Neighborhood Open Forum will be held at the Salvation Army at 1137 North Santa Fe Avenue, at 7:00 p.m. this evening. Mayor Warner thanked the community for its support of the victims of the Hesston tornado. Commissioner Frank asked the City staff to check into policy and staff requirements of the Salina Municipal Court to handle the increased case load so cases can be prosecuted which involve damage to city property and cleanup of hazardous material so the citizens are not assessed.
